Latest Patents
Morinaga's latest patents include a radio circuit apparatus and radio communication equipment. The radio circuit apparatus is designed to enhance the efficiency of signal transmission and reception. It utilizes a first local oscillator to input the output signal into a transmitted frequency converter and a frequency divider. This design allows for the modulation of the output signal with a baseband signal, ultimately miniaturizing the radio circuit apparatus by reducing unnecessary components. Additionally, his power amplifier patent features an input signal splitting part that divides the input signal into two output signals. This design incorporates a push-pull operation for high output levels and a single-ended operation for low output levels, showcasing Morinaga's innovative approach to amplifier technology.
